Top 5 Cruise Locations First, a cruise to the Caribbean is one which should be on everyone`s Bucket List. With eternal and perpetual sunny skies, a crystal clear sea, luxurious carpet like beaches and a cloudless blue sky, you would be forgiven for imagining that you are in a fantasy paradise location. You would then smell and taste local seafood delicacies and fruity cocktails and remember that you are actually experiencing the holiday of a lifetime. With friendly locals, the Caribbean is a must for any cruiser. You should consider choosing a cruise that gives you time in each location, so that you are able to sample delightful local cuisine and chat to friendly locals. St John`s is the main port in Antigua and is perfect for accessing the popular beaches. St Lucia and Les Pitons mountains are also superb places to visit, full of luscious greenery and spectacular views. |

Second, a cruise to Trinidad and Tobago is one that is not to be missed. Trinidad is the home of steel pan and calypso music. It is a vibrant and culturally interesting destination. Dotted with floral growth and with a very diverse population, Trinidad was once the destination for career-driven business types, whereas now it is a holiday destination for all. Sunny skies, quiet beaches, clean, healthy and happy lifestyles are around the corner in Trinidad and Tobago. Third, a trip across the Atlantic from Southampton is one not to be missed. A particular favourite is the cruise which takes you to New York for Thanksgiving or Independence Day celebrations. People also choose to spend money Christmas shopping in New York and why not arrive in style in one of the luxurious and comfortable cruise ships? Fourth, a trip around the Iberian coast brings sunshine, excellent stop off points such as Tenerife and Lisbon and is close enough to home that, should you wish to, you could jump on a plane to join the cruise or go one way via the cruise and return on a plane. Finally, an interesting, but much colder, cruise is that of the trip to Norway, Sweden and Denmark. With superb views, including the most clear night sky you will ever see, Scandinavian cruises are an alternative for those who do not like the heat. You can, however, still sunbathe, but you might become extremely cold very quickly! With that in mind, why not choose from the Queen Mary, the biggest cruise ship to ever dock in Liverpool, or with the cunard Queen Elizabeth. Both fantastic cruise ships which come highly recommended for their entertainment, food and friendly staff as well as efficient service. Above all, wherever you choose, enjoy your trip! |
